For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public school serving 478 students in the neighborhood of Rivertown Warehouse District, Detroit, MI.
The top ranked public school in Rivertown Warehouse District is University Preparatory Science And Math Psad High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
The neighborhood of Rivertown Warehouse District, Detroit, MI public school have an average math proficiency score of 5% (versus the Michigan public school average of 34%), and reading proficiency score of 12% (versus the 46%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 100%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Michigan public school average of 37% (majority Black).
